Welcome to U.A.C. [O.S.A.]
login / register
Status: Guest
Архивы форума | iddqd.ru
Wolf 3D
ПравилаПравила ПоискПоиск
18+
Doomsday Пред.  1, 2, 3 ... 39, 40, 41
   Список разделов - Doom и его порты - DoomsdayОтветить
АвторСообщение
alekv
= Major =
Next rank: Lieutenant Colonel after 94 pointsМодератор форума
3196

Doom Rate: 1.94

Posts quality: +345
Ссылка на пост №801 Отправлено: 30.05.17 12:32:30
блин порту реально не хватает совместимости с здумом что бы переплюнуть гоззу =)
по графике весьма впечатляет. Даже шайнмап хорошая штука.

Еще интересно, линии, сектора конвертятся в 3д меш(полигоны)?
Кажется jdoom так делал, если не ошибаюсь.
Если да, то думаю бамп на стенах\полах лишь дело времени в т.ч. и нормали.
theleo_ua :
(также я пока слабо представляю, каким боком делать поддержку зскрипта)

никаким, его можно и не делать. подавляющее большинство модов работает без зскрипта.
А вообще лучше вместо этого дерьма, добавить сразу c# что бы не долбать мозги юзерам с самописным синтаксисом и не плодить армию недопрограммистов.

Рейтинг сообщения: +1, отметил(и): VladGuardian
1 3 1
theleo_ua
= 1st Lieutenant =
Next rank: - Captain - after 164 points
1926

Doom Rate: 1.81

Posts quality: +146
Ссылка на пост №802 Отправлено: 31.05.17 20:22:03
alekv :
блин порту реально не хватает совместимости с здумом что бы переплюнуть гоззу


Порт разрабатывает один человек, и у него мало времени на разработку порта, соответственно она идет медленно. Т.е. даже если он отменит все текущие таски и начнет пилить совместимость с здумом, боюсь что она будет в роли "догоняющего" со всеми вытекающими в стиле "разрабатывая мод под думсдей всегда будут подсознательно ожидать, что что-то работает не так, и требуется перепроверять на гздуме" или "играя в гздумный мод в думсдее будут подсознательно ожидать глюков"

Теперь добавляем к этому следующее:
1) думсдей не наследовался с здума или наследника здума, как это было в зандронуме например
2) смотрим, как дела с здум/гздум совместимостью у зандронума

Т.е. думсдею мало того, что придется разработать скелет (который нахаляву достался зандронуму например), так еще и придумать, как решить пункт 2, который не смогли решить авторы зандронума

blblx :
Вот о чём сейчас полумал... Модельки с бампом ну или нормалями есть, а вот к примеру если взять текстуры на картах, то там бамп будет работать? Ну к примеру в папку с названием texstures я кладу альтернативную текстуру bigdoor2, а вот как должен бамп называться "bigdoor2_bump"?


theleo_ua :
Я могу спросить у тех кто шарит


alekv :
Еще интересно, линии, сектора конвертятся в 3д меш(полигоны)?
Кажется jdoom так делал, если не ошибаюсь.
Если да, то думаю бамп на стенах\полах лишь дело времени в т.ч. и нормали.


Ответ тех кто шарит: Привет, бамп пока только на моделях, но у Скайджейка есть планы переписать рендерер мира, чтобы использовать шейдеры и даже заменять текстуры на полигональные модели. Где-то в роадмапе это даже указано.
Да линии и сектора конвертятся в полигоны.

alekv :
никаким, его можно и не делать. подавляющее большинство модов работает без зскрипта.


1) Есть уверенность, что так будет и дальше?
2) То меньшинство модов, которое не работает без поддержки зскрипта, точно не заинтересует пользователей, например таких ? Тот же d4d/d4t вроде без зскрипта либо не работает либо адски урезан и теряет смысл

alekv :
А вообще лучше вместо этого дерьма, добавить сразу c# что бы не долбать мозги юзерам с самописным синтаксисом и не плодить армию недопрограммистов.


Ну - добавляя c# ты не прибавляешь совместимости с гоззой и ее текущими модами. Также мне интересен нюанс проблем (например мод случайно удалит файлы на твоем винте или всю оперативку сожрет по причине утечек в коде) и безопасности (например потенциальных вирусов) в таких модах

А так то да - адекватная поддержка c# не помешала бы, но с другой стороны, если учесть начало моего комментария, что у автора порта мало времени и даже текущие задачи он делает медленно, то боюсь что поддержка c# в порте не много радости принесет моддерам и юзерам

З.Ы. В моих влажных мечтах - вынос декорейта/acs/зскрипта в отдельные проекты типа libdecorate, libacs, libzscript, чтобы их последние версии легко (ну относительно легко) можно было подрубать к другим портам. По аналогии, думсдеевские фичи, тобишь libshinemaps, libfbx и прочее. Жаль, что это всего лишь мечты

Рейтинг сообщения: +1, отметил(и): VladGuardian
2 1
ZZYZX
Lieutenant Colonel
Next rank: - Colonel - after 100 pointsМодератор форума
3940

Doom Rate: 1.78

Posts quality: +729
Ссылка на пост №803 Отправлено: 01.06.17 10:24:21
Юнити спокойно работает с шарпом. С вирусами проблем нет :)
Проще пихнуть рендерер карт дума в юньку, чем шарп в думсдей. Говорю как человек, таки писавший опенгл рендерер секторов с триангуляцией и прочим блекджеком. Причём заодно будут и шейдеры с бампами/нормалами.

з.ы. d4t таки работает без зскрипта на декоре. В этом весь смысл, и есть поддержка зандронума.

Рейтинг сообщения: +1, отметил(и): VladGuardian
2 2 1
alekv
= Major =
Next rank: Lieutenant Colonel after 94 pointsМодератор форума
3196

Doom Rate: 1.94

Posts quality: +345
Ссылка на пост №804 Отправлено: 01.06.17 11:57:59
ZZYZX :
Проще пихнуть рендерер карт дума в юньку, чем шарп в думсдей.

Это хорошая идея, только если не будут перенесены баги и ограничения гздума
а переносить ваниль на юнити, кажется не интересным.
1 3 1
ZZYZX
Lieutenant Colonel
Next rank: - Colonel - after 100 pointsМодератор форума
3940

Doom Rate: 1.78

Posts quality: +729
Ссылка на пост №805 Отправлено: 01.06.17 12:26:42
Ничего переносить не надо, кроме самих карт.
Но тут проблема будет в том, что с юнькой карты в гздб и карты в игре будут несколько разными, и смысл потеряется.
Проще спиратить плагин маппинга под юньку ) http://www.procore3d.com
2 2 1
Gadavre
= Master Corporal =
Next rank: - Sergeant - after 32 points
258

Doom Rate: 1.84

Posts quality: +1
Ссылка на пост №806 Отправлено: 10.08.17 22:16:17
Как Вам последняя версия порта? Или же старая. но стабильная версия 1.8.6 2005-го года остается лучшей и более удобной для игры?
Ссылка
theleo_ua
= 1st Lieutenant =
Next rank: - Captain - after 164 points
1926

Doom Rate: 1.81

Posts quality: +146
Ссылка на пост №807 Отправлено: 11.08.17 17:20:47
Gadavre, я уже давно забыл что такое 1.8.6, для меня теперь старая версия порта это 1.15.8

На текущий момент в 1.15.8 нет практически ничего, чего нет в 2.0.3, кроме некоторых мелких багов типа "не работающих настроек в паках в 2.0.3", которые скоро починят

Так что я полностью перешел на 2.х ветку (сейчас юзаю 2.0.3), и 1.15.8 юзаю только по вспомогательным причинам, например чтобы проверить какие-то баги, которые появились в 2.х, но которых не было в 1.15.8 (к слову, 1.8.6 пока валяется на диске для таких же целей (например репортил баг с текстурами, который был как в 2.х, так и в 1.15.8, и надо было показать скрины из 1.8.6, где все работало как надо), но юзается крайне редко )

Gadavre :
Или же старая. но стабильная версия 1.8.6 2005-го года остается лучшей и более удобной для игры?


Мое мнение - стоит переходить на 2.х и все найденные баги/проблемы репортить, ибо 1.8.6 и 1.15.8 не поддерживают новый формат моделей и в них есть куча багов, которые либо пификшены в 2.х, либо будут пофикшены в 2.х

Тут примерно как в гоззе с OpenAL: я на новую версию перешел, просто все найденные баги репортил (и их уже пофиксили)
2 1
Gadavre
= Master Corporal =
Next rank: - Sergeant - after 32 points
258

Doom Rate: 1.84

Posts quality: +1
Ссылка на пост №808 Отправлено: 17.08.17 20:29:18
theleo_ua :
Мое мнение - стоит переходить на 2.х и все найденные баги/проблемы репортить, ибо 1.8.6 и 1.15.8 не поддерживают новый формат моделей
Как бы оно так, но... Привык я к 1.8.6. Привык к простеньким визуальным эффектам старой версии. В новых версиях добавили, например, искры от файербола, я бы отключил корону и искры, только не знаю как. В 1.8.6 все было с этим просто :)

Как помню, годика 2 или 3 назад буквально все предлагали выкинуть новые глюченные беты от 1.9.0 и выше в помойку и остаться на 1.8.6. Тем более подключение 3d моделей в то время было таким заумным, что Jake Crusher аж написал целую статью, как подключать 3D модели.:)
theleo_ua
= 1st Lieutenant =
Next rank: - Captain - after 164 points
1926

Doom Rate: 1.81

Posts quality: +146
Ссылка на пост №809 Отправлено: 20.08.17 21:11:09
У меня проблем с 2.х версией нет (кроме тех проблем, которые есть даже в 1.8.6 и 1.15.8), а если тебе нравится 1.8.6, то юзай 1.8.6

Искры от фаербола это партиклы, или в опциях отключи particle effects или просто удали соответствующие файлы паков с партиклами
2 1
Страница 41 из 41Перейти наверх Пред.  1, 2, 3 ... 39, 40, 41
   Список разделов - Doom и его порты - Doomsday